Welcome aboard! Quick note on how we handle schema migrations at Plinkworth without downtime: we always do expand-contract. Add the new column, dual-write from the Fernbridge app layer, backfill in batches, then drop the old column a release later. Never rename in place. If a migration locks up and you get booted from the admin console mid-run, you'll need to recover your operator account before retrying. The recovery flow in Quillgate will prompt you, and you'll need the recovery passphrase below.

unlock words, yawig-kagef: gordor-holvan-ulaael-pramir-ulaiel-tamdor

**Q: Why do converted amounts in Pennywhistle sometimes drift by a cent?**

Good catch — it's rounding, not tampering. Pennywhistle converts via a base currency (the "Drovnia ledger" internally), so two half-cent roundings can stack into a one-cent drift. From a security standpoint it's bounded, audited, and can't be exploited to siphon value; the reconciliation job in Tallowmere zeroes it out nightly. If you want to inspect the sealed audit ledger yourself, unlock the reviewer vault with the recovery passphrase below.

strongbox words: gilok-druion-briath-wendor-briion-prawyn-fenion-oliir-casdor-holius-briius-gilath-gilael-pelys

Subject: Cut-over complete — Sievecraft validator plugin system. Hi — documenting last night's cut-over for your review. We migrated all fourteen production validators from the legacy monolith hooks to the new Sievecraft plugin loader. Each plugin now runs sandboxed with an explicit capability manifest, and unsigned plugins are rejected at load time. Rollback artifacts are retained for thirty days. For your audit, the production loader is currently running with these settings.

config for tajof-tajef:
ralael:
  pin: 3468
  metrics_host: metrics.ralael.lumicsys.internal
  tenant: casath
  seal: seal_c325d9c6